SSL证书(Secure Sockets Layer Certificate)是一种用于在Web服务器和浏览器之间建立安全连接的数字证书。它通过加密数据传输来保护用户的隐私和数据安全,确保信息在传输过程中不被窃取或篡改。
基础概念
SSL证书包含公钥和私钥,服务器使用私钥对数据进行加密,而浏览器则使用公钥来解密数据。这种加密方式称为公钥基础设施(PKI)。
相关优势
- 数据加密:保护数据在传输过程中不被窃取或篡改。
- 身份验证:验证网站的身份,防止DNS劫持等攻击。
- 增强信任:用户看到锁形图标会认为网站更安全,增加用户信任。
类型
- DV SSL(Domain Validation SSL):最基础的SSL证书,仅验证域名所有权。
- OV SSL(Organization Validation SSL):验证域名所有权及公司身份。
- EV SSL(Extended Validation SSL):最严格的SSL证书,验证域名所有权、公司身份及法律合规性。
应用场景
- 电子商务网站:保护用户支付信息。
- 政府机构网站:确保信息传输的安全性和真实性。
- 金融网站:保护用户的财务数据。
检查网站SSL证书的方法
你可以使用浏览器内置的工具来检查网站的SSL证书。以下是具体步骤:
- 打开浏览器,访问目标网站。
- 点击浏览器地址栏左侧的锁形图标。
- 在弹出的菜单中,选择“证书”(不同浏览器可能有不同的选项名称)。
- 在证书信息页面,你可以查看证书的详细信息,包括颁发机构、有效期、公钥等。
常见问题及解决方法
问题1:网站SSL证书过期
原因:SSL证书有有效期,过期后需要重新申请或更新。
解决方法:
- 联系网站管理员更新SSL证书。
- 如果你是网站管理员,可以使用证书颁发机构(CA)提供的工具来更新证书。
问题2:网站SSL证书不受信任
原因:可能是证书颁发机构不被浏览器信任,或者证书链不完整。
解决方法:
- 确保使用受信任的证书颁发机构颁发的证书。
- 检查证书链是否完整,确保所有中间证书都已正确安装。
问题3:网站SSL证书配置错误
原因:可能是服务器配置错误,导致SSL证书无法正确加载。
解决方法:
- 检查服务器配置文件,确保SSL证书和私钥路径正确。
- 确保服务器支持所使用的SSL协议版本和加密套件。
参考链接
希望这些信息对你有所帮助!如果你有更多关于SSL证书的问题,欢迎继续提问。